You'll want to review your login permission as there are different levels of access when logging in to an account in QBO. Before doing so, make sure you are the admin of the account. If not, you'll need to ask the admin to update your user permission.

 

Here's how to manage user access:

 

  1. Go to the Gear icon.
  2. Select Manage users.
  3. Find the user you want to edit. Then select Edit in the Action column.
    • You can change the User type.
    • Select the user settings you want to manage (if applicable).
  4. Select Save.
  5. Ask the user to sign out and sign in again into QuickBooks Online to see the updates.

If the setup is correct and you're still unable to edit the reports, let's do the following steps to fix this. This behavior is likely caused by a cache-related problem. In this case, you can rule this out by using an incognito or private browser: 

 

  • Google Chrome: press Ctrl + Shift + N.
  • Mozilla Firefox: press Ctrl + Shift + P
  • Safari (new versions) : press Command + Shift + N

Next, log in to your QuickBooks Online account and try assigning an expense to the customer/job again. When you're able to do so, you'll want to go back to the regular browser and clear the cache. Close any instances of your browser to complete the process. Another thing you can do is to use other supported browsers.
